The New Saints eye semi-finals

The New Saints have been handed a favourable tie at struggling Llandudno in the quarter-finals of the JD Welsh Cup.

The Saints, six times winners of the competition, have already defeated the Welsh Premier’s bottom club three times this season, twice in the league (6-1 and 4-0) and once in the Nathaniel MG Cup (5-0).

Holders Connah’s Quay Nomads travel to Caernarfon Town, while Bala Town host recently crowned Nathaniel Cup winners Cardiff Met University.

Cambrian & Clydach, the only non-Welsh Premier side remaining in the competition, head to Barry Town United.

The ties are scheduled for Saturday, March 2.
